About 6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id
6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id (PubChem CID 150259527) has the molecular formula C15H8F4N2O2
and a molecular weight of 324.23 g/mol. Its IUPAC name is 6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id.

What is the SMILES notation for 6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id?
The canonical SMILES for 6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id is O=C(O)n1ccc2ccc(-c3cc(F)ccc3C(F)(F)F)nc21.
What is the InChIKey of 6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id?
The InChIKey is GBGFUZDYUPVJCL-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H8F4N2O2/c16-9-2-3-11(15(17,18)19)10(7-9)12-4-1-8-5-6-21(14(22)23)13(8)20-12/h1-7H,(H,22,23).
What are the key properties of 6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id?
6-[5-fluoro-2-(trifluoromethyl)phenyl]pyrrolo[2,3-b]pyridine-1-carboxylic acid has a molecular weight of 324.23 g/mol, XLogP of 4.39, 1 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
